Big Boss Battle
Gaming News, Reviews & Opinions
Browsing Tag

World of Horror

Rob’s Top 5 Games of 2023

Yes, folks, we’re back! Thank you for being patient whilst we dealt with that unpleasantness just now. We told Lara to lay off the scotch. Multiple times. We’d like to apologise to Kratos and assure him that we’ll cover his medical bills...